Skyway Trail Background

The concept of a trail linking Telluride and Ouray was born in 1988 with dialogue between interests in Ouray and San Miguel Counties. A grant request was submitted and approved under the Intermodal Surface Transportation Efficiency Act of 1991. This grant was administered by San Miguel County, with the County of Ouray as a partner, for the purpose of studying the possibility of a route from the Town of Telluride to the City of Ouray.

The Southwestern Colorado Data Center, a publicly and privately funded non-profit information provider received the contract to conduct the study and provide a document upon which to base further consensus and possible design, engineering, and construction of a proposed trail.
